FSA Brand Background and Technical Strength
Global Innovation Enterprise
FSA was established in 1990, headquartered in Italy, and is an international company specializing in bicycle component research and manufacturing. The brand, named "Full Speed Ahead," reflects its relentless pursuit of speed and performance. After more than thirty years of development, FSA has become an important supplier to major bicycle brands worldwide.

FSA Wheelset Product Line Overview
Road Bike Series
K-Force Series
FSA's top-tier road bike wheelset series, representing the brand's highest technical standards:
-
K-Force WE: Flagship carbon fiber wheelset
- Weight: approximately 1420g (tubular) / 1480g (clincher)
- Rim depth: 35mm
- Material: high-modulus carbon fiber
- Hub: FSA ceramic bearing hub
- Application: professional racing, high-end training
- Price: $2,000-2,500
-
K-Force DB: Disc brake specific version
- Specifically designed for modern disc brake road bikes
- Center Lock rotor interface
- Internal width increased to 21mm
- Supports tubeless systems
SLK Series
High-performance carbon fiber wheelset balancing performance and price:
- SLK Carbon: Full carbon fiber construction
- Weight: approximately 1550g
- Rim depth: 38mm/50mm options
- Price range: $1,200-1,600
Gradient Series
Mid-to-high-end choice focusing on aerodynamic performance:
- Progressive rim design
- Optimized crosswind stability
- Suitable for long-distance and flat road riding
- Both rim brake and disc brake versions available

Installation, Setup and Maintenance
Installation Points
Hub Adjustment
- Check bearing preload
- Confirm proper freehub installation
- Adjust brake clearance (disc brake versions)
Wheel Truing
- Check wheel roundness
- Adjust spoke tension uniformity
- Confirm wheel centering alignment
Brake System
- Rim brake versions need brake track break-in
- Disc brake versions install rotors and break-in
- Adjust brake position and feel
Daily Maintenance
Cleaning Care
- Regularly clean rims and spokes
- Maintain good hub sealing
- Avoid brake track oil contamination
Performance Checks
- Regularly check spoke tension
- Observe rim wear conditions
- Check hub rotation smoothness
- Test braking performance
Professional Maintenance
- Recommend professional inspection every 5000km
- Replace bearing grease when necessary
- Adjust or replace worn components
